Transaction 660cfe335f4ca20049c8828fea61266183b224607b31d118c2979f39297af910
1 Input
1 Output
-
660cfe335f4ca20049c8828fea61266183b224607b31d118c2979f39297af910:0
- value
- 139793
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 620cb391d3ee117a7ddb9ad84aec81e711ac0db1 OP_EQUAL
- address
- 3AdTMrYEZxq49Lbpihy7yryUxwHdUq3iYJ